Tampa Bay Buccaneers quarterback Baker Mayfield (knee, oblique) is ready to go for the Week 8 matchup against the New Orleans Saints. Mayfield is a little banged up right now, but that's not going to stop him from suiting up. The 28-year-old wasn't able to offer much to fantasy managers last week. Mayfield threw for 228 passing yards with one touchdown and one interception in the loss to the Detroit Lions. As always, Mayfield will be playing shorthanded with Chris Godwin (leg), Mike Evans (collarbone), and Bucky Irving (foot, shoulder) all sidelined. However, the Bucs will still have Emeka Egbuka, so Mayfield should be able to offer QB1 value against the below average Saints defense.

Tuesday, October 7, 11:19 AM
According to Cincinnati Bengals beat writer Paul Dehner Jr. of The Athletic, the team's internal options at quarterback are "not in consideration" to replace current starter Jake Browning in Week 6 against the Green Bay Packers. As such, any potential replacement would have to come from outside the building. In three starts since replacing Bengals quarterback Joe Burrow (toe) under center, Browning has thrown for 516 yards, four touchdowns, and five interceptions while leading the team to an 0-3 record. However, it does not appear Cincinnati has confidence in current backup QB Brett Rypien or practice squad QB options Mike White and Sean Clifford. Most likely, Browning will be the signal-caller in a difficult Week 6 matchup against the Packers.
